061703P.pdf 02/01/2007 Alejandro A. Garcia v. John Mathes
U.S. Court of Appeals Case No: 06-1703
U.S. District Court for the Southern District of Iowa - Des Moines
[PUBLISHED] [Riley, Author, with Beam and Smith, Circuit Judges]
Prisoner case - habeas. State courts did not unreasonably apply clearly
established federal law by excluding evidence showing medical
malpractice was an intervening and superseding cause of the victim's
death, as under Iowa law the intervening medical act must be the sole
proximate cause of death, and the medical evidence showed the act in
question was not the sole proximate cause.
